Anisotropic meaning


Anisotropic is a term used to describe a material or substance that exhibits different physical properties in different directions. This means that the material has different properties when measured along different axes.

For example, a piece of wood may be stronger along the grain than across it, or a crystal may have different refractive indices in different directions.
